"matchit" based router (#363)
* "matchit" based router * Update changelog * Remove dependency on `regex` * Docs * Fix typos * Also mention route order in root module docs * Update CHANGELOG.md Co-authored-by: Jonas Platte <[email protected]> * Document that `/:key` and `/foo` overlaps * Provide good error message for wildcards in routes * minor clean ups * Make `Router` cheaper to clone * Ensure middleware still only applies to routes above * Remove call to issues from changelog We're aware of the short coming :) * Fix tests on 1.51 Co-authored-by: Jonas Platte <[email protected]>
